Why cp is always greater than cv

Answer» The heat capacity at\xa0constant pressure CP\xa0is\xa0greater than\xa0the heat capacity atconstant volume CV\xa0, because when heat is added at\xa0constant pressure, the substance expands and work. QV =\xa0CV\xa0△T = △U + W = △U because no work is done. Therefore, dU =\xa0CV\xa0dT and\xa0CV\xa0= dU dT .
